The Supreme Judicial Council issued a show-cause notice to Justice Mazahir Naqvi.

According to sources, the Supreme Judicial Council issued a show-cause notice to Justice Mazahar Ali Naqvi on the basis of majority, two members of the council opposed the show-cause notice to Justice Mazahar as against three.

A meeting of the Supreme Judicial Council was held under the chairmanship of Chief Justice of Pakistan Qazi Faez Isa.

Justice Sardar Tariq Masood, Justice Ejazul Ahsan Chief Justice Lahore High Court Amir Bhatti and Chief Justice Balochistan High Court Justice Naeem Akhtar Afghan attended the Supreme Judicial Council meeting.

Registrar Supreme Court and Attorney General Pakistan also attended the meeting of Supreme Judicial Council.

According to sources, a show-cause notice has been issued to Justice Mazahir Naqvi in the meeting and he has been asked to respond to the show-cause notice by November 10.

The Pakistan Bar Council has filed a reference against Justice Mazahir Naqvi on the alleged audio leak.

In the meeting of the Supreme Judicial Council, the pending complaints related to the judges were reviewed.

The complaint of miss conduct against Supreme Court Judge Justice Mazahir Naqvi and former Chairman NAB Justice Retired Javed Iqbal was also examined in the meeting.

The issue of complaints against Supreme Court judge Justice Mazahir Naqvi for his alleged involvement in the audio leak scandal was discussed.

According to Pakistan Bar Council sources, the Supreme Judicial Council has issued a show-cause notice to Justice Mazahir Naqvi on the complaint of the Supreme Court Bar, Pakistan Bar and other lawyers’ organizations and directed him to file a written response by November 10.
